This is a simple and fast tool to determine the gear-inches, speed and cadence (RPM) of various chainring, sprocket, and wheel-size combinations on track racing bikes. It is also suitable for other single-speed bicycles. It includes options for traditional track calculations, or exact results, and your speed in either miles (MPH) or kilometers (Km/h). Does not require an Internet connection.

To use, simply enter the number of teeth in your bike's chainring (the gear by the pedals) and your sprocket (the gear on your rear wheel). This calculates your gear-inches; bigger numbers represent taller gears. You may also elect to enter either your actual speed, which calculates your approximate RPM (cadence), or your actual RPM, which calculates your approximate speed.

The default settings calculate traditional track-racing gear-inches, which are based on a standard 27-inch tire size. But you can also elect to calculate the gear-inches for any specific tire size you choose, by measuring the circumference of your tires in millimeters: 2096 mm is typical for 700x23c tires, for example.
